The LTC693CN#PBF is a state-of-the-art microprocessor supervisory circuit designed and manufactured by Linear Technology, a company renowned for its high-performance analog integrated circuits. This essential component provides microprocessor systems with robust monitoring capabilities to ensure reliable operation even under adverse conditions.
Key Features:
- Power Supply Monitoring: The LTC693CN#PBF actively monitors the power supply voltage, ensuring that it remains within acceptable thresholds for stable microprocessor operation.
- Power Failure Warning: It features an early warning system for impending power failure, allowing for safe shutdown procedures to be initiated, thereby protecting data integrity and preventing system corruption.
- Memory Write Protection: During power-up, power-down, or brownout conditions, the device provides write protection for memory, safeguarding critical data.
- Automatic Battery Backup Switching: The circuit seamlessly switches to battery backup mode when main power is compromised, ensuring continuous operation of critical system functions.
- Low Battery Detection: It includes a low battery detection feature that alerts the system to a failing battery, prompting maintenance or replacement before system performance is impacted.
- Reset Output: The LTC693CN#PBF generates a reset output signal upon detection of out-of-tolerance power supply conditions, automatically resetting the microprocessor to a known state.
- Temperature Range: The device operates over a wide temperature range, making it suitable for industrial applications with extreme environmental conditions.

Product Quality and Reliability:
Linear Technology's LTC693CN#PBF is built to the highest quality standards, ensuring reliability and performance. The device is available in a 16-pin narrow DIP package, with the #PBF suffix indicating lead-free and RoHS-compliant construction.
